Presented by Contact and Young Identity

Young Identity are Manchester’s finest young spoken word performers. Join them for a boisterous night of poetry, music and visual art.

One Mic Stand is centred around a Poetry Slam, in which 10 poets are given only 3 minutes each to wow the audience with their lyrical mastery and charismatic delivery to battle it out to gain the top spot and win the grand prize of £50!

In the past we’ve showcased the likes of JP Cooper, Thabo and Mica Millar and for this edition we bring you the sounds of July7, an R n B singer, songwriter and producer making waves on the scene. If that wasn’t enough we’ve also got BBC 1Xtra Words First finalist Amina Jama bringing her inimitable poetry to the stage and Reece Williams premiering work from his upcoming debut EP ‘Warren’.
